Walkers are not known for grit, but thats not to say that there all like that but as a whole they are not. Thats why most, not all but most big game hunters that prefer grit use plotts. I have seen gritty and non gritty in them all. And if anyone has any doubt, just go to the coast of NC and get on a mean fighting bear and see which ones hit the road first. Seen it plenty of times. If you want grit, why not breed them to a good cur?
